Damian Broadley

Partner
A J Park Law & A J Park Patent Attorneys
Wellington

Damian specialises in the clearance, protection and management of trade marks. He is also a copyright and domain name specialist.  Damian joined A J Park in 1993 and has been a partner since 2001.

Many of Damian's clients are Fortune 500 corporations. Damian also acts for New Zealand companies and in particular larger corporates and exporters. Industries he is particularly experienced in include telecommunications, film, television, music, pharmaceuticals, computer and internet, automobile, transport and finance.

Damian's work covers all aspects of trade mark and related intellectual property law. He advises on commercialisation of intellectual property rights and the development, management and protection of intellectual property strategies. Damian has been involved in developing and implementing brand and domain name protection frameworks and acted in a number of domain name disputes involving high profile names. He was also a member of the InternetNZ committee that established the dispute resolution system for .nz domain names.
